Understanding the Articles of Dissolution (Registered Series) in Oklahoma:

The Articles of Dissolution (Registered Series) in Oklahoma serve as a formal declaration to dissolve a registered series within a limited liability company. This form plays a crucial role in the state's business regulations by ensuring that businesses comply with the necessary procedures when closing a series.

Who Needs to File the Articles of Dissolution (Registered Series) in Oklahoma?

Business owners with registered series within their limited liability company are required to file the Articles of Dissolution when closing a series. It's essential to understand the specific criteria that determine whether this form needs to be filed to avoid any compliance issues.
